World Food Safety Day is observed  to raise awareness about the prevention, detection and management of "foodborne risks, contributing to food security, human health, economic prosperity, agriculture, market access, tourism and sustainable development," according to WHO. The first ever World Food Safety Day, was adopted by the United Nations General Assembly on December 2018. The theme of the first ever Food Safety Day 2019 was "Food Safety, everyone's business". 

The United Nations (UN) has assigned two of its agencies, the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) and the World Health Organization (WHO) to lead efforts in promoting food safety around the world. In this direction the World Health Organisation (WHO) in collaboration with the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) of the United Nations decided to celebrate 7th June as the First food safety day since 7th June 2019. The World Food Safety Day 2020 will be celebrated virtually due to the spread of COVID-19 disease.
